Bifold doors are a popular choice for homeowners looking to create a seamless transition between indoor and outdoor living spaces These doors consist of multiple panels that fold back onto themselves, creating a wide opening that allows for unobstructed views and easy access to the outdoors Bifold doors are typically made of materials such as aluminum, timber, or uPVC, with each material offering its own set of benefits and drawbacks.

When it comes to pricing, bifold doors can vary significantly depending on factors such as material, size, and quality On average, the cost of bifold doors in the UK can range from £1,500 to £6,000 per set Aluminum bifold doors are generally the most expensive option, with prices starting at around £2,000 for a standard-sized door Timber bifold doors are a popular choice for their aesthetic appeal and natural warmth, with prices starting at around £1,500 for a basic model uPVC bifold doors are the most budget-friendly option, with prices starting at around £1,000 for a standard-sized door.

In addition to the material, the size of the bifold doors can also impact the cost of installation Larger doors with more panels will require more materials and labor, which can drive up the overall cost On average, a standard-sized bifold door with three to four panels will cost around £1,500 to £2,500, while larger doors with five to six panels can cost upwards of £3,000 to £6,000 It is important to consider the size of your space and your budget when deciding on the number of panels for your bifold doors.

In addition to the cost of the doors themselves, you will also need to factor in the cost of installation Hiring a professional installer is recommended to ensure that your bifold doors are properly fitted and functioning correctly The cost of installation can vary depending on factors such as the complexity of the job, the location of your home, and the experience of the installer On average, the cost of installation for bifold doors in the UK can range from £500 to £1,500, so be sure to get quotes from multiple installers to find the best price for your project.

When budgeting for bifold doors, it is important to consider any additional costs that may arise during the installation process This can include the cost of removing existing doors, repairing or reinforcing the door frame, and adding finishing touches such as blinds or handles It is recommended to create a detailed budget that includes all potential costs to avoid any surprises down the line.
